Undergraduate and Graduate Course Syllabi
Notes:
- Outdoor Education academic programs were in the Department of Kinesiology prior to fall 2011. The new Department of Outdoor Education was established to recognize these programs of distinction on August 1, 2010. During the 2012 academic year courses previously listed as KINS courses were approved as ODED courses. Some of the new prefix courses have not been taught yet and will be uploaded to this page as they are developed as ODED courses.
- The new program of study for the B.S. in Outdoor Education was approved in spring 2011 with substantial changes to course sequence and content. Several new courses that were approved at this time will not be implemented until current students in the old program graduate and students entering the program in fall 2011 are ready to take them. Therefore some undergraduate courses will be uploaded to this page as they are implemented.
- Course descriptions for all courses are available in official catalogs for the 2012 academic year.
